Abstract:
In order to deal with the compound interference in the control of jig air valve opening and improve the separation stability and efficiency, a PID fuzzy compound control of jig air valve opening under the compound interference is proposed. Firstly, based on the jig principle model and knowledge rules, the influence of air valve parameters on key indicators such as bed looseness is analyzed, and the control target is established; Secondly, the PID controller is designed to realize the basic feedback regulation, and the fuzzy controller is constructed to dynamically adjust the PID parameters according to the deviation and change rate, so as to enhance the robustness of the system; Finally, the improved genetic algorithm is introduced to optimize the PID fuzzy composite control parameters to improve the control performance. The experimental results show that the proposed method has good dynamic response performance and anti-interference ability, can quickly and stably track the input changes, reduce the overshoot, and improve the sorting accuracy.
